He held her in his arms. She lay motionless, blood trickling down the side of her face. He knew this would happen, he knew, and yet he could stop the sobs that tore past his lips. Caressing the side of her face he held her close against his chest. The ray of happiness which had shone through the clouded sky had faded and he couldn’t think of any other chance to ever have a glimpse at it again. Her skin was cold against his fingers, her scent dying out, he pressed a shaky kiss to her forehead.

“Hyeji…” was all he could say, helplessly calling to her dying spirit unaware of the battle being waged. The one that had caused his suffering had taken away everything precious to him. His family, his humanity, and now the one person he had grown to love.

The sky overhead seemed to darken further as he held her close. Her parents would find that she was missing. They would come to investigate. They would come and find him with her body in his hands and they would kill him. What a perfect ending. Almost poetic. He couldn’t find any more tears to even shed as he gazed at her face, smoothing the long hair back.

She gasped, eyes flying open. Taekwoon nearly dropped her in shock as she caught hold of his shoulders to prevent herself from falling. Taking deep breaths of air, she looked at him and smiled, placing a hand on his cheek.

“I couldn’t leave you alone.”

“H-how…” he stammered, hands wandering to grip at her, just to make sure she was right there. Not a figment of his imagination.

“I gave back his fang. He was incomplete without it. Now his spirit is no longer attached to the earth.” she tried to explain to the best of her ability. Taekwoon could only frown in confusion as Hyeji pulled herself together.

“How do I explain this? The spirit of the wolf your ancestor had killed lingered on the earth because they buried him incomplete. Which was why the curse gripped your family. Because the fang of the wolf was given to my ancestor. My spirit ended the wolf’s with the same fang.” Taekwoon’s eyes searched her neck for the same fang which had been there. The string had snapped and fallen on the ground, right on the mound. “The curse is lifted, Taekwoon… or so I hope.” she whispered, eyes shining with hope.

“I don’t care about the curse.” Taekwoon said, hands reaching to hold hers “right now. In this moment. You’re back. You’re alright. That’s all that matters to me.”

He saw her eyes softening “Taekwoon…” he cupped her cheek.

“You’re too important for me to let go. Right now, we’ll take things one step at a time. I’m not going to run away.Curse or no curse, I love you and I want to be with you. If you’ll have me. ” He said, looking hopefully into her eyes as tears sprung in her’s.

“I love you too Taekwoon. We’ll figure this out together. I know we can.” And thus Hyeji fell into his embrace yet again. He pressed soft kisses all over her face, so glad that the ray of happiness he thought he had lost was shining right on him. When their lips finally met, he felt like he could conquer any curse as long as it meant keeping Hyeji by his side. This kiss wasn’t about passion, no, this was a promise. Sealed with a kiss.

Taekwoon was right about one thing. The search parties did come and found the two of the huddled by the tree, safe and sound. There was relief and a little confusion at their appearance. No one understood what had happened there, but all they knew was that the two were safe and sound. They smiled at each other as they were escorted back to the town’s hospital. Hyeji’s parents fussing over them as the group headed there. Hyeji’s little finger hooked with Taekwoon’s and he gazed at her.

Everything would be alright as long as he had his Red
